Matthew MACLEAN

MACLEAN, Matthew, N.P.
Personal Data
- Party
- Liberal
- Constituency
- Cape Breton North and Victoria (Nova Scotia)
- Birth Date
- December 13, 1879
- Deceased Date
- April 7, 1953
- Website
- http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Matthew_MacLean
- PARLINFO
- http://www.parl.gc.ca/parlinfo/Files/Parliamentarian.aspx?Item=ebd54ad2-9fac-4782-926d-47676cc87c1a&Language=E&Section=ALL
- Profession
- insurance agent, notary
Parliamentary Career
- October 18, 1937 - January 25, 1940
- LIBCape Breton North and Victoria (Nova Scotia)
- March 26, 1940 - April 16, 1945
- LIBCape Breton North and Victoria (Nova Scotia)
- June 11, 1945 - April 30, 1949
- LIBCape Breton North and Victoria (Nova Scotia)
- June 27, 1949 - June 13, 1953
- LIBCape Breton North and Victoria (Nova Scotia)
